Clean up ScopedThreadStateChange to use ObjPtr
Also fixed inclusion of -inl.h files in .h files by adding
scoped_object_access-inl.h and scoped_fast_natvie_object_access-inl.h
Changed AddLocalReference / Decode to use ObjPtr.
Changed libartbenchmark to be debug to avoid linkage errors.
Bug: 31113334
Test: test-art-host
